Ugo to go to Leeds

Leeds United have completed the signing former England centre-back Ugo Ehiogu from Middlesborough.
He will join the club on loan until 1 January.
The deal was tied up just hours before the closing of the loan window.
Dennis Wise has long stressed his desire to strengthen at the back after telling both Paul Butler and Sean Gregan that they no longer had a future at the club.
Leeds had to beat off the challenge of several Championship clubs, including Barnsley, to land the experienced defender.
Ehiogu had been a loan target for West Brom earlier this season, but Boro refused to let him leave the Riverside Stadium at the time.
